Full Description
This examination assesses the principles and methodologies involved in Genome-Wide Association Studies (GWAS) and their applications in clinical genetics. Understanding the significance of GWAS findings is critical for identifying genetic markers associated with diseases.
GWAS has revolutionized the approach to gene-disease associations, allowing for the identification of susceptibility factors and enhancing precision medicine. The results from these studies influence both research directions and clinical practice.
Candidates will demonstrate their ability to interpret GWAS data, discuss its clinical relevance, and articulate the implications of findings for diagnosis and treatment.
Discussions may also encompass statistical considerations and limitations inherent in GWAS, providing a comprehensive understanding of the subject.
